Detailed Solution

Given parabolas y2=4ax and x2=4ay By solving these  two equations we get  x4=16a2(4ax) x3=64a3 x=0 or x=4a   y=0 or  y=4a

point of intersection  are (0,0) and  (4a, 4a) 

it passes through (0,0) then d=0

 2bx+3cy=0 Again it passes through the point (4a,4a) then 4a(2b+3c)=0 2b+3c=0 

then

d2+(2b+3c)2=0
